Blonde Trailer: Marilyn Monroe’s estate offers support to Ana de Armas over accent Criticism

Blonde Trailer: Blonde Starring Ana de Armas as Marilyn Monroe which is all set to premiere on Netflix on September 28, has become the talk of the town and is all set for its grand Debut!
Meanwhile, Blonde is Adapted from an eponymous 2000 novel by Joyce Carol Oates, and the film looks at Norma Jeane Mortenson’s journey to becoming a Hollywood icon- Marilyn Monroe. 

On July 28th, Netflix released the film’s official trailer, leaving the fans outraged. And why is that so?
Well as according to the audience, Ana de Armas, who is portraying the Hollywood icon, her accent did not entirely match Monroe’s iconic breathy tone. And the Internet is at War Over that.

Sharing her take on this, De Armas previously told The Times of London that she had spent nearly an entire year working on her Monroe accent for ‘Blonde’ before the filming actually started.

And the actor added, “It took me nine months of dialect coaching. Even some practicing and some ADR sessions (to get the accent right). It was a big torture, so exhausting. My brain was fried.”

Marilyn Monroe estate Defends

While Blonde is not authorised by Monroe’s estate, but the group stands by de Armas and offered her some support.

Marc Rosen who is the president of entertainment at Authentic Brands Group and owns the Marilyn Monroe Estate Said, “Marilyn Monroe is a singular Hollywood and pop culture icon that transcends generations and history.”

He also added that, “Any actor that steps into that role knows they have big shoes to fill. Based on the trailer alone, it looks like Ana was a great casting choice as she captures Marilyn’s glamour, humanity and vulnerability. We can’t wait to see the film in its entirety!”.

While Most of the complaints about de Armas’ from the viewer’s side noted that she maintained her Cuban accent, which is not how Monroe sounded. De Armas told an entertainment magazine in 2020 that Dominik’s decision to cast a Cuban actor as an American icon was “groundbreaking.” But it seems a lot don’t agree with this casting.

de Armas had once told a magazine that she had to audition for Marilyn’s role once and director Andrew Dominik just loved her!
